Ottawa is a great city for its historical sights. However, Grand Teton National Park is not known for its sights and museums.
Ottawa offers many unique museums, sights, and landmarks that will make for a memorable trip. As the country's capital, there are a large number of museums to explore. There are summer national museums in town which include the National Gallery of Canada, the Museum of History, the Science and Technology Museum, the Aviation and Space Museum, the Agriculture and Food Museum, the Museum of Nature, and the War Museum.
Grand Teton National Park offers a handful of options for museums and historical sights. The Visitor Centers have exhibits and other informational sessions.
Ottawa is a popular place for its local flavors and cuisine. However, Grand Teton National Park is not known for its local cuisine and restaurants.
There are plenty of up and coming restaurants around Ottawa. The culinary scene highlights many Canadian classics like poutine and maple donuts (and, of course, the classic Tim Horton's), but you'll also find plenty of international options like shawarma.
You'll find the standard options when it comes to food in Grand Teton National Park. There are a number of restaurants and cafes around the park where you can enjoy a meal, often with a view.

Grand Teton National Park is a world-class destination for its hiking trails. However, Ottawa is not a hiking destination.
People visit Grand Teton National Park specifically for its hiking, as the natural beauty is well-known. Grand Teton National Park has more than 250 miles of trails that make their way through the mountains and around the rugged landscapes. There are hikes that range from short strolls to backcountry, mult-day trails and it's not uncommon to see wildlife.

Ottawa is a popular place for shopping. However, Grand Teton National Park is not known for its shopping opportunities.
Plenty of visitors enjoy shopping while in Ottawa. You'll find large malls, outlets, and shopping streets that are fun to browse. Some of the favorite shopping areas include ByWard Market, Sparks Street, and CF Rideau Centre.

Ottawa is a nice destination for couples. The city is filled with parks and green spaces where you can enjoy flowers or peaceful walks. Commissioners Park is particularly nice and known for its tulips during the spring season. Dow's Lake is a nice place for ice skating in the winter or kayaking in the summer. The average daily cost (per person) in Grand Teton National Park is $196, while the average daily cost in Ottawa is $134.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ination.
